Mistral is seeking a Controller to oversee the company’s day-to-day accounting. The Controller will serve as a crucial part of the accounting management team responsible for managing the accounting staff, owning the general ledger and month-end close process, and driving operational efficiency within the accounting function. The Controller will collaborate closely with senior leadership to support financial decision-making and maintain the integrity of financial records. This is a full-time, on-site position at our Bethesda, MD headquarters.
In addition, the Controller will be part of the Company compliance team.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
Accounting Operations & General Ledger Management:
- Responsibility for the company’s accounting and financial records, ensuring accuracy, completeness and timeliness.
- Oversee AP/AR operations to ensure timely payments and collections.
- Assist with payroll processing
- Oversee month-end, quarter-end and year-end close processes, including reconciliations, journal entries, and account analysis.
- Ensure all accounting operations are efficient, accurate, and auditable, and compliant with GAAP and SEC requirements.
Audit & Internal Controls:
- Maintain and monitor robust internal controls over financial reporting to meet SOX compliance standards.
- Coordinate with external auditors during quarterly and annual audits, including preparation of schedules, reconciliations, and responses to inquiries.
- Ensure timely remediation of any audit findings.
Process Improvement & Operational Efficiency
- Identify opportunities to streamline accounting processes and implement best practices to increase efficiency and accuracy.
- Lead ERP or accounting system upgrades and ensure integration with other business systems.
Stakeholder Communication:
Reporting financial information to the CEO, CFO, senior management, and other stakeholders.
Team Management:
Overseeing the day-to-day accounting operation and staff and ensuring efficient workflow within the accounting department.
REPORTING:
- The selected Controller will report to the VP/Director of Accounting
- This role will have direct reports
QUALIFICATIONS:
- A bachelor's degree in accounting or finance.
- Must be a Certified Public Accountant (CPA).
- At least 7 years’ experience in managing corporate accounting. Knowledge and experience in accounting for manufacturing/production processes is a significant advantage.
- Experience at a publicly traded company is required.
- Familiarity with ERP software, MS NAV, accounting software, human resources software, and other financial tools.
- A master’s degree is preferred.
